    What you will study

    On our masters in Social Psychology, you’ll gain the knowledge and skills needed to address real-world societal, intergroup and interpersonal issues by exploring topics such as prejudice and discrimination, moral judgement, and emotions. You'll examine how individuals and groups interact to construct and maintain identities and how psychological principles can be applied to promote social change, strengthen communities and improve relationships.

    We’ll provide you with an in-depth understanding of contemporary approaches and the skills required to conduct research in the field, through cutting-edge methods and techniques. We’ll also give you an insight into qualitative and quantitative research methods, including the use of statistical software, ensuring you have a solid foundation to collect, analyse and interpret data.

    You’ll complete a research dissertation that will allow you to carry out studies on important topics in the field, with previous students researching:

    • Psychosocial Factors Influencing Loneliness Among LGBTQIA+ Individuals
    • Examining the Impact of Idealised and Body-Positive Social Media Imagery on Mens Body Image
    • Bullying and Children's Rights: A Quantitative Study of Defending and Passive Bystander Behaviours in Online Bullying Among Children Aged 13 to 16
    • What Are Narcissistic Friends For? Evaluating How Narcissism Affects Friendship Quality and Fulfillment of Friendship Functions.

    Research groups

    You’ll be invited to join our Social Psychology Research Group where our members conduct research for the EU, UK research councils, industry organisations and charities. Recent projects have included:

    • Dyadic Nostalgia in Couple Relationships
    • Enhancing LGBTQ+ Inclusion in STEM and Energy Research
    • Perceptions and Effects of Gender-Based Violence Subversive Humour.

    You’ll participate in discussions about research topics, findings and publications, and you’ll benefit from our links with renowned research institutions across the world. We also have a host of external speakers who visit us and present their work, and a collection of seminars and workshops, allowing you to network with like-minded individuals.

    Facilities

    Our psychology facilities will give you access to the latest equipment, including a virtual reality suite to simulate real-life scenarios and two observation labs. You'll be able to monitor eye tracking and physiological measures such as earlobe temperature, heart rate and galvanic skin response, both in the lab and remotely, using mobile data loggers.

    You’ll also have access to an extensive library of psychometric and clinical tests, 20 bookable project rooms, a breakout space, equipment lockers and a computer lab.

    Entry Requirements

    To apply for one of our postgraduate courses that require a UK 2:1, you must achieve 75% overall or a GPA of 3.5/5.0 or 3.0/4.0.

    For courses that require a UK 2:2, you must achieve 65% overall, or a GPA of either 3.25 out of 5.0 or 2.6 out of 4.0.

    For courses that require a UK first-class degree to be eligible for a scholarship, you must achieve 80% overall.
